Abstract

Mediation refers to the process by which the parties to the dispute are brought together by a common person or mediator or arbitrator, in a common or common denominator. In this study, it is aimed to evaluate the concept of mediation in the context of merit and specialization. In this study, literature sources and document scanning model were used. In the research, descriptive scanning model and content analysis methods and mediation were examined. According to the results obtained in the study, trust and impartiality are the most important requirements in mediation processes, as in all legal processes. On the other hand, while mediation processes lacking merit in a short term, they can make the problems in the middle term more chronic and grave in the long run. For the most effective and successful fulfillment of the public interest from the mediation process, the main objective should be not only to resolve non-compromise issues temporarily, but to produce permanent solutions. For this purpose, there are big assignments for public administrators and individuals and institutions considering to provide mediation services if necessary.
